HDPE Pipe 1/2 Inch for Water Supply Applications
For reliable and cost-effective water distribution, select 1/2 inch HDPE pipe. This versatile material is renowned for its durability, resistance to corrosion, and exceptional flow characteristics. HDPE pipes are widely employed in residential and commercial settings for a range of water supply requirements, including indoor plumbing, irrigation systems, and subterranean utility lines.
- Key advantages of using HDPE pipe for water supply include:
- Durability: HDPE pipes are remarkably resistant to cracking, bursting, and degradation caused by environmental factors such as UV radiation and winter conditions.
- Smooth interior walls : The smooth inner surface of HDPE pipe minimizes friction, allowing for efficient water flow and reducing energy consumption.
- Lightweight construction: HDPE pipes are lighter than traditional materials like metal, facilitating easier handling and installation.
Moreover, HDPE pipe is often more affordable compared to other piping materials in the long run due to its low maintenance requirements.
